About Tian Li
Tian Li is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Pharmacology, Plant Science, Biotechnology and Nutrition and Dietetics, having authored 53 papers that have together received 941 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Microbial Natural Products and Biosynthesis (13 papers), Wheat and Barley Genetics and Pathology (11 papers), Marine Sponges and Natural Products (10 papers), Genetic Mapping and Diversity in Plants and Animals (8 papers), Genetics and Plant Breeding (7 papers), Fungal Biology and Applications (7 papers), Free Radicals and Antioxidants (5 papers) and Fatty Acid Research and Health (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biotechnology (104 citations), Nutrition and Dietetics (159 citations), Food Science (172 citations), Biochemistry (54 citations) and Organic Chemistry (250 citations). Tian Li has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Qin Guo, Yang Qu, Qiang Wang, Yu Zhang, Chenyang Hao, Lei Zheng, Changhong Liu, Ling Yan, Xueyong Zhang and Chunlin Tang.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Asian Natural Products Research, Food Chemistry, LWT, BMC Plant Biology and International Journal of Food Science & Technology.
